Output d88907e44cc2bc17b3dc82bdb9d91044ecb78b712d39903c616669c33f296b21:2

value
36950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ab3111b4d2e36391e96c05c4f1c5d6947c37e782 OP_EQUAL
address
3HJCFjRAcWH5Ea4vScHnqLjBZfzG9Ecnjg
transaction
d88907e44cc2bc17b3dc82bdb9d91044ecb78b712d39903c616669c33f296b21
spent
true